INTEGRAL CARTON AND TRAY ARRANGEMENTS
A lidding device (102) includes a first panel (104) comprising a lid (106) configured to cover and seal a food container (108). A second panel (110) is foldably connected to the first panel. A third panel (112) includes a bottom panel opposite the lid, wherein the second panel is foldably connected to the first panel and the third panel. A fourth panel (114) is foldably connected to at least one of the first panel and the third panel, wherein the fourth panel and second panel are configured to at least partially enclose a food container between the second and fourth panels.
AN ASEPTIC LIQUID PACKAGING CONTAINER
An aseptic liquid packaging container (100) is disclosed. The liquid packaging container made from a cup stock paperboard and may be a laminate structure (200b) configured to form the container. It can be a plurality of layers configured to form the laminate structure (200b) wherein at least one layer of the plurality of layers is a cup stock paperboard layer (204b).
Corrugated packages for pre-saturated wipes
An example material sheet dispenser includes: a wall portion configured to form a volume; a first end portion comprising one or more sections attached to a first end of the wall portion and configured to cover a first end of the volume; and a second end portion comprising: a dispensing section attached to a second end of the wall portion and configured to cover a second end of the volume opposite the first end of the volume, and the dispensing section having a dispensing aperture configured to permit dispensing of sheets of a wiping material; and a cover section attached to the wall portion and configured to cover the dispensing aperture.
Flexible Carton Liner
Disclosed herein is a flexible liner for a paneled fiberboard carton. The flexible liner is adhesively attached to the inner sides of the carton's panels creating demonstrably stronger carton walls and having the same top-load compression strength as standard, conventionally constructed liners. The flexible liners disclosed herein are unique in their die-cut construction resulting in liner panels, and optionally flaps, that are separated from adjacent liner panels by a plurality of slots and flexibly attached to adjacent panels by a plurality of bridges.

TAMPER EVIDENT HYBRID RESEALABLE CONTAINER
The present invention relates to a composite container comprising a bottom film layer and a top film layer at least partially adhered to the bottom film layer. The top film layer is scored to form at least one resealable flap and at least one pull tab which is not adhered to the bottom film layer. The bottom film layer comprises at least one cavity opening. A cardboard layer is adhered on its lower surface to the upper surface of the top film layer, wherein the cardboard layer has at least one cavity opening which is substantially aligned with the scoring of the top film layer resealable flap and the cardboard layer is perforated to define a perimeter of at least one pull tab which is substantially aligned with and adhered, on its underside, to the upper surface of the top film layer pull tab.
Latex polymers made using metallic-base-neutralized surfactant and blush-resistant coating compositions containing such polymers
An aqueous coating composition is provided that is preferably substantially free of bisphenol A. The coating composition is preferably a latex-based coating composition that includes a latex polymer formed from ingredients including an anionic and/or zwitterionic surfactant that includes one or more acid groups neutralized with a metallic base. The coating composition is useful in coating metal substrates such as, for example, interior and/or exterior surfaces of food or beverage containers.

INSULATED CONTAINER AND METHOD OF ASSEMBLING AN INSULATED CONTAINER
There is disclosed an insulated container comprising: an external housing having abase and sidewall structure extending upwardly from the base to a first height, an upper end of the sidewall structure defining an opening of the external housing; an insert having an insert base and insert sidewall structure extending upwardly from the insert base, the insert being configured to be snugly received within the external housing, and the insert sidewall structure having a second height that is less than the first height so as to define a shoulder portion; and a thermally insulating lid having an upper surface and a lower surface, the lid being configured to be received through the opening of the external housing and positioned with edge parts of the lower surface of the lid resting on the shoulder portion defined by the insert sidewall structure; wherein the sidewall structure of the external housing is provided with at least one slit positioned above the upper surface of the lid to allow a portion of the sidewall structure of the external housing above the slit to be moveable to an inverted position so as to engage the upper surface of the lid and to hold the lid in position.
THERMAL LINER AND THERMAL CONTAINER COMPRISING SAME
A thermal liner comprising a plurality of planar panel sections and being configurable in an operative configuration defining a closed inner chamber delimited by a bottom wall, four side walls and a top wall. Each one of the bottom wall, the side walls and the top wall comprises an inner sheet, an outer sheet and at least one intermediate sheet. A first core layer extends between the inner sheet and a respective one of the at least one intermediate sheet and defines a plurality of geometrically patterned structures inbetween. A second core layer extends between the outer sheet and a respective one of the at least one intermediate sheet and defines a plurality of geometrically patterned structures inbetween. A container having a thermal liner such as the one described above is also provided.
